netapp.ontap.na_ontap_aggregate – NetApp ONTAP manage aggregates.
Note
This plugin is part of the netapp.ontap collection (version 21.14.1).
You might already have this collection installed if you are using the ansible
package.
It is not included in ansible-core
.
To check whether it is installed, run ansible-galaxy collection list
.
To install it, use: ansible-galaxy collection install netapp.ontap
.
To use it in a playbook, specify: netapp.ontap.na_ontap_aggregate
.
New in version 2.6.0: of netapp.ontap
Requirements
The below requirements are needed on the host that executes this module.
Ansible 2.9
Python3 netapp-lib (2018.11.13) or later. Install using ‘pip install netapp-lib’
netapp-lib 2020.3.12 is strongly recommended as it provides better error reporting for connection issues.
A physical or virtual clustered Data ONTAP system. The modules support Data ONTAP 9.1 and onward.
REST support requires ONTAP 9.6 or later.
To enable http on the cluster you must run the following commands ‘set -privilege advanced;’ ‘system services web modify -http-enabled true;’

Examples
- name: Create Aggregates and wait 5 minutes until aggregate is online
netapp.ontap.na_ontap_aggregate:
state: present
service_state: online
name: ansibleAggr
disk_count: 1
wait_for_online: True
time_out: 300
snaplock_type: non_snaplock
hostname: "{{ netapp_hostname }}"
username: "{{ netapp_username }}"
password: "{{ netapp_password }}"
- name: Manage Aggregates
netapp.ontap.na_ontap_aggregate:
state: present
service_state: offline
unmount_volumes: true
name: ansibleAggr
disk_count: 1
hostname: "{{ netapp_hostname }}"
username: "{{ netapp_username }}"
password: "{{ netapp_password }}"
- name: Attach object store
netapp.ontap.na_ontap_aggregate:
state: present
name: aggr4
object_store_name: sgws_305
hostname: "{{ netapp_hostname }}"
username: "{{ netapp_username }}"
password: "{{ netapp_password }}"
- name: Rename Aggregates
netapp.ontap.na_ontap_aggregate:
state: present
service_state: online
from_name: ansibleAggr
name: ansibleAggr2
disk_count: 1
hostname: "{{ netapp_hostname }}"
username: "{{ netapp_username }}"
password: "{{ netapp_password }}"
- name: Delete Aggregates
netapp.ontap.na_ontap_aggregate:
state: absent
service_state: offline
unmount_volumes: true
name: ansibleAggr
hostname: "{{ netapp_hostname }}"
username: "{{ netapp_username }}"
password: "{{ netapp_password }}"
